Suck Fumes, you are the first to notice, besides those that have heard my throttle from my incar.

Sat. race....first I would like to say that many guys had a great race!  Danny thanks as always for posting the videos, they are helpful to most all in our class....Also you drove well all weekend.  I had no idea Danny had fallen so far back after the contact he had at Canada corner.   Showed alot of determination to catch back up.   The race itself for me was interesting, it took 3 laps for the tires to feel good, and then in the middle of lap five my brake pedal would not rebound when I pressed it (felt like pressing power brake pedal with key in the car off) this created lock up on the front tires entering  turn 5 and Canada.   Knowing I would just have to deal with this, I just backed off my brake points.   Last lap....had the lead, but Stearns and Danny got a great run down the mid strait....I took middle of the track with 2 cars bearing down, Stearns went outside and Danny made a move inside on exit....Danny hit the side of my car, something that is very common in turn 5, and completed the pass.  I felt fairly confident about the back side (except for braking in Canada), as we entered the Carosel I was on Dannys bumper, up ahead I could see a lapped car, it looked like Danny and I would both catch him in the Kink (so unlike last year!) about 1/3 way around the Carosel I backed off the throttle, hoping to get a run, and hoping the lapped car would slow Danny....this is rare!, but the plan worked, and I was able to get a run, unfortunately when I backed off Voytek was able to get a great run on myself.   We went to the inside of Danny, under braking into Canada Voytek had pad kick back and in hindsight I was 2ft farther to the inside than I should have been.....a few bumps from Voytek put my front tire in the dirt and rear tire on the rumbles.....when his car left my bumper it was already too late, I was going around.... this sucks for all, the top 3 cars all with issues....as with most issues on the track, there is usually a string of events, not just one that lead up to these things.

Sunday race is pretty simple...got a great start, led most of the race, but the RT front corner suspension from the crash with Danny started moving around and the car was terrible.   Got 3rd, but was very ready to get out of the car.

I really appreciate the tallent of drivers at the front of our class, and its honestly the single reason I race SM and not another class.
